diff options
author | Oliver Smith <osmith@sysmocom.de> | 2021-03-08 08:33:47 +0100 |
---|---|---|
committer | Oliver Smith <osmith@sysmocom.de> | 2021-03-08 08:37:06 +0100 |
commit | 62ad58ad56e51b5b454f0f048a3eb171d70b17d0 (patch) | |
tree | 7d53694eaeecce0b04188b918fc39ad414007385 | |
parent | 1031d9b88441e8ca928f2e5c2205d34c80a1c5ed (diff) |
contrib/prepare_upload.sh: fix cd problems
Call the script from the proper directory, and cd into the topdir on top
of the script. Fixes:
/build/contrib/jenkins.sh: line 71: contrib/prepare_upload.sh: No such file or directory
Related: OS#4413
Change-Id: Icbfaa5579aab887830ca90b24a2e322df8d98f4f
-rwxr-xr-x | contrib/jenkins.sh | 2 | ||||
-rwxr-xr-x | contrib/prepare_upload.sh | 2 |
2 files changed, 3 insertions, 1 deletions
diff --git a/contrib/jenkins.sh b/contrib/jenkins.sh index 2ad7a7f..8268bcf 100755 --- a/contrib/jenkins.sh +++ b/contrib/jenkins.sh @@ -68,7 +68,7 @@ rm -rf $TOPDIR/firmware/bin/simtrace-cardem* if [ "x$publish" = "x--publish" ]; then echo echo "=============== UPLOAD BUILD ==============" - contrib/prepare_upload.sh + $TOPDIR/contrib/prepare_upload.sh cat > "/build/known_hosts" <<EOF [rita.osmocom.org]:48 ssh-rsa AAAAB3NzaC1yc2EAAAADAQABAAABAQDDgQ9HntlpWNmh953a2Gc8NysKE4orOatVT1wQkyzhARnfYUerRuwyNr1GqMyBKdSI9amYVBXJIOUFcpV81niA7zQRUs66bpIMkE9/rHxBd81SkorEPOIS84W4vm3SZtuNqa+fADcqe88Hcb0ZdTzjKILuwi19gzrQyME2knHY71EOETe9Yow5RD2hTIpB5ecNxI0LUKDq+Ii8HfBvndPBIr0BWYDugckQ3Bocf+yn/tn2/GZieFEyFpBGF/MnLbAAfUKIdeyFRX7ufaiWWz5yKAfEhtziqdAGZaXNaLG6gkpy3EixOAy6ZXuTAk3b3Y0FUmDjhOHllbPmTOcKMry9 diff --git a/contrib/prepare_upload.sh b/contrib/prepare_upload.sh index 8242fd4..90b3278 100755 --- a/contrib/prepare_upload.sh +++ b/contrib/prepare_upload.sh @@ -1,5 +1,7 @@ #!/bin/sh -e # Create copies of binaries with -latest, -$GIT_VERSION (OS#4413, OS#3452) +cd "$(dirname "$0")/.." + GIT_VERSION="$(./git-version-gen .tarball-version)" echo "Copying binaries with "-latest" and "-$GIT_VERSION" appended..." |